Role Purpose

As a Payroll Administrator, you will be responsible for the accurate and compliant processing of payroll. This includes managing the timely payment of salaries, wages, bonuses, and other earnings, while ensuring compliance with all tax, benefit, and statutory regulations. You will also maintain precise records of payments and deductions, ensure tax obligations are met on time, manage payroll accounting entries, and support ongoing process improvements.
